This symbol challenges the dreamer to explore the depths of their psyche, confronting the raw energy within and finding ways to channel it constructively., Cultural Context:, Different cultures have unique interpretations of lava. In Hawaiian culture, for instance, lava is associated with Pele, the goddess of volcanoes, symbolizing creation and destruction. Her presence in dreams might be seen as a call for renewal and transformation. In contrast, some Pacific Islander cultures view lava as a destructive force, emphasizing caution and respect for nature's power. In contemporary Western interpretations, lava often reflects inner turmoil or impending change, echoing the unpredictability and intensity of natural volcanic activity., Understanding ${name} dreams:, Lava, as a dream symbol, represents a powerful and often overwhelming force of nature.
